Christmas bubbles for clinically extremely vulnerable
Posted on: 9 December 2020
You are still able to form a Christmas bubble if you are clinically extremely vulnerable, but it does involve greater risks for you. You will minimise your risk of infection if you limit social contact with people that you do not live with.
